Les meilleures solutions de load balancing en 2025

Face à la montée des exigences de disponibilité et de performance des services web en 2025, l’équilibrage de charge s’impose comme un élément fondamental pour maintenir une infrastructure résiliente et réactive. La capacité à répartir efficacement le trafic sur plusieurs serveurs garantit non seulement la continuité du service, mais contribue aussi à optimiser les temps de réponse, cruciaux pour le SEO technique et l’expérience utilisateur.

1. Fondamentaux et fonctionnement des solutions de load balancing en 2025

Le load balancing se traduit par la distribution intelligente du trafic réseau entre plusieurs serveurs afin d’éviter la saturation d’un point unique, frein potentiel à la performance et à la disponibilité. Cette répartition repose sur des algorithmes variés (round-robin, least connections, IP hash) qui adaptent la charge en fonction du contexte applicatif.

  • Contrôle continu : les solutions effectuent des vérifications régulières de santé des serveurs pour rediriger le trafic en cas de défaillance.
  • Adaptabilité : prise en charge de différentes couches du modèle OSI, notamment couche 4 (transport) et couche 7 (application), pour un routage plus fin.
  • Optimisation des ressources : réduction des goulets d’étranglement et prévention des surcharges.
A lire aussi :  Pont laser : la solution sans fil ultra haut débit pour entreprises
Avantages Objectifs Techniques
Haute disponibilité Éviter les interruptions longues Health checks, failover automatique
Performances accrues Réduire le temps de réponse serveur (TTFB) Répartition intelligente du trafic
Évolutivité Supporter la croissance du trafic Scalabilité horizontale
découvrez les meilleures solutions de load balancing en 2025 pour optimiser la répartition de charge, améliorer la performance et garantir la disponibilité de vos applications.

1.1. Éléments clés pour choisir une solution adaptée

En 2025, les exigences évoluent vers plus de flexibilité et de sécurité. Voici les critères majeurs à surveiller :

  • Scalabilité dynamique : capacité à absorber les pics de trafic via l’auto-scaling.
  • Protocoles supportés : HTTP/HTTPS, TCP, UDP, HTTP/3 et QUIC sont à privilégier pour les environnements modernes.
  • Intégration avec le cloud : compatibilité étroite avec les services cloud publics comme AWS, Azure, Google Cloud.
  • Modules de sécurité intégrés : WAF, protection DDoS, TLS/mTLS obligatoires pour renforcer la posture défensive.

2. Panorama des meilleures solutions de load balancing en 2025

Plusieurs acteurs dominent en termes de performances, fonctionnalités et intégrations cloud. Voici un comparatif pragmatique des solutions de référence :

Produit Types de Load Balancing Points forts Cas d’usage
AWS Elastic Load Balancing ALB, NLB, GWLB (HTTP, TCP, UDP) Auto-scaling, intégration AWS, monitoring avancé Environnements cloud AWS exigeants en résilience
F5 Big-IP Local & Global Server Load Balancing, iRules personnalisées Gestion avancée du trafic, sécurité AI-centric Entreprises nécessitant une gestion fine et haute sécurité
Azure Application Gateway Load balancing L7 avec routage URL WAF intégré, SSL termination, haute scalabilité Applications web hébergées sur Microsoft Azure
Google Cloud Load Balancing Global et régional, multiplateforme HTTP/2 et HTTP/3 Haute disponibilité mondiale, intégration GKE Charge mondiale avec besoins gén AI-aware (scaling spécifique)
NGINX Plus Load balancing L4/L7, health checks actifs Cache intégré, configuration dynamique Cloud native apps, microservices, conteneurs

2.1. Alternatives open source et spécifiques

Les solutions open source et spécialisées continuent de se développer, offrant une grande flexibilité et contrôle aux développeurs :

  • HAProxy : performant, low-latency, support HTTP/3 et QUIC, LTS 3.2 adopté en 2025.
  • Traefik : orienté conteneurs et cloud-native, intégration Kubernetes, SSL automatisé.
  • Kemp LoadMaster : solution mixte matérielle/logicielle avec gestion avancée SSL et scripts L7.
  • Avi Networks (VMware Avi Load Balancer) : orchestration multi-cloud, WAF intelligent et maillage de services.
  • Cloudflare : CDN + load balancing intégré, proxy évolué en Rust pour gains de performances et sécurité renforcée.
A lire aussi :  Fortinet : à quoi sert un boîtier FortiGate dans un réseau ?

3. Points clés pour déployer un load balancer performant et sécurisé

Le déploiement d’une solution d’équilibrage de charge ne se limite pas à sa mise en œuvre initiale. Plusieurs paramètres influencent les gains réels en performance et fiabilité.

  • Surveiller la santé des serveurs en exploitant les sondes actives pour éviter l’envoi de trafic vers des ressources défaillantes.
  • Configurer l’auto-scaling pour que la capacité s’ajuste automatiquement aux variations de charge.
  • Composer avec les règles Layer 7 pour le routage selon le contenu, comme les URL, afin d’optimiser la distribution.
  • Implémenter des protections intégrées telles que le WAF, la terminaison SSL/TLS avec mTLS et la mitigation DDoS.
  • Veiller à la simplicité de gestion via des interfaces claires, le monitoring en temps réel et l’automatisation complète.
Pratique recommandée Impact Outil/Technologie associée
Load balancing multi-zone/region Haute disponibilité et tolerance aux pannes AWS ELB, Azure Gateway, Google Cloud LB
Automatisation par Infrastructure as Code Réduction erreurs humaines, rapidité des déploiements Terraform, Helm charts, Ansible
Mise en place de WAF intégré Protection contre attaques web courantes ModSecurity, F5 Advanced WAF, Azure WAF

3.1. Erreurs fréquentes à éviter lors du choix et de la configuration

  • Ignorer la vérification continue : ne pas activer les probes de santé peut entraîner l’envoi de trafic vers des serveurs défaillants.
  • Omettre la segmentation : un routage global sans règles Layer 7 peut générer une distribution inefficace des groupes d’utilisateurs.
  • Négliger la sécurité : choisir une solution sans module WAF ou sans chiffrement des flux affaiblit la protection globale.
  • Sous-estimer la scalabilité : opter pour une solution rigide empêche la gestion des pics de trafic.

Comment fonctionne un load balancer logiciel ?

Un load balancer logiciel joue le rôle de répartiteur en dirigeant les requêtes entrantes vers le serveur optimal selon des règles définies, tout en effectuant des contrôles de santé pour garantir la disponibilité.

A lire aussi :  Comment se connecter facilement à un portail Wi-Fi Ucopia ?

Quelles sont les méthodes courantes de répartition du trafic ?

Les méthodes les plus répandues sont round-robin, least connections, IP hash, et weighted load balancing, chacune adaptée selon la nature et la charge des applications.

Les solutions open source conviennent-elles aux PME ?

Oui, HAProxy, Traefik et NGINX Plus offrent un excellent compromis entre coût et performance, permettant aux PME d’assurer une gestion de trafic robuste sans investissement excessif.

Quels sont les critères clés pour choisir un load balancer en 2025 ?

Les critères principaux incluent la scalabilité, la sécurité intégrée (WAF, TLS), la compatibilité cloud, la facilité d’automatisation et la gestion centralisée.

Comment combiner DNS-based et L7 load balancing ?

Une architecture commune associe un équilibrage DNS (GSLB) pour la répartition géographique au load balancing L7 pour un routage précis et sécurisé au niveau applicatif.